There was one listed for sale on this site in 2017. The asking price at the time was $279.00 --
http://forum.talkingmachine.info/viewto ... w=previous
-- I don't know if it eventually sold for that or more, but around $300-$400 seems to be the going rate for the gold plated version, and from what I've seen over the years, the nickel plated ones are priced in the same ballpark.

I agree that Ebay is an excellent tool for checking an item's sold price, to determine trends, etc., but as Phonogal noted, the ones on ebay right now are all pot metal nickel plated Orthophonic sound boxes, (though many look to be in relatively good to excellent condition!)
For those new to the hobby, or unfamiliar with the various styles of reproducers, the easiest way to tell them apart at a glance is that the pot metal version has nine openings in the front plate, while the solid brass version has seven.
Also, the pot metal version's needle bar fulcrum's casing is molded or cast as part of the front plate, while on the brass version, it's attached.
